This guy right here is everything that has been wrong with English football and coaching at junior level over the years. I don't mean any disrespect to the bloke, he played pro football, better than I did and fair play to him for that. He was 5,10 11 stone at 14/15 years old. Literally running through or over players and banging in the goals, there was no way to stop it. Then, they get picked up by a professional club and nothing really changes for them, their game doesn't change. In fact, in his case at least it gets worse because this kid who has spent his life galloping through on goal with no one able to catch him, has suddenly got a whole lot more room to run into on a pro pitch. You wonder where the person was that takes this kind of kid aside and says look son, you need to have a bit more about you than just strength and speed. Once he'd lost the edge physically, he became basically redundant.
